MADRID FESTIVAL - you can’t win ‘em all…

Filed under: News — ravenmad @ 8:11 am

Hi,
We’d like to apologize to the people that waited all day to see us only to have us play about 30 min (at 3.30am!!!) heres the story -
we were all flying from Washington DC on Thursday Sept 28th - due to bad weather, Mark’s flight into DC was cancelled & he missed the flight to Paris..so he had to fly the next day - and had to pay full price for another ticket as he was a no-show..so he gets into Paris the day of the show at 1:00pm or so, due to the crazy connection time in Paris (35 mins) he missed that connection too & ended up arriving into Madrid at 7.00pm - the airline lost his guitars and amp rack just to add insult to injury.(I had brought one guitar for Mark so he had that at least)
A few bands were nice enough to move their shows forward (thanks Destruction, thanks Doro!!) but the promotor asked the reps of the others & they wanted to play at their alloted times…so we were told we could play last..at 2 - 3 am & there was a possiblity we could get cut off. So, we gave it a shot…were told to stop & left. then we were told to come back and play another song - unfortunately the sound crew had already started breaking stuff down so we had no vocals..no monitors..so it was “arse upwards” all the way. So Mark was travelling from Thursday at noon until 10.00pm when he arrived at the gig - after the gig we got 2 hours sleep & back to the airport to face more cancellations, delays etc…aaaaaggggghhh

The audience: amazingly ALL of them stayed to the end - we thank you - we apologize & hope to make it up to you with a REAL show in 2007

all the best,
RAVEN

RAVEN AT BANG YOUR HEAD 2006

Filed under: News — ravenmad @ 10:03 am

Hi!!!
finally back home after our BANG YOUR HEAD appearance - we kicked ass!!
After the usual abuse at the airport fighting over excess baggage,
non-existant legroom and bad in-flight movies we arrived in Stuttgart & were whisked away to a small village a few miles away from the festival - great hotel - great food!! everyone in the town was football mad (world cup) and festival mad too!

We did the warm up show at the WOM club on Thursday just a few miles away
from the main festival site in Balingen Germany, before us was Tim
“Ripper”Owens band “Beyond Fear” - Tim sounding excellent - the new songs
especially!

We did a 65 min set & made sure we mixed it up - we made sure we did
different sets for each gig…
Heres the club set:(AS BEST AS i CAN REMEMBER!)
TAKE CONTROL(1ST TIME SINCE 1985!!!)
LIVE AT THE INFERNO
ALL FOR ONE
CRASH BANG WALLOP
BREAKING YOU DOWN
SPEED/RUN/MIND MEDLEY
INQUISITOR
ON & ON
BREAK THE CHAIN
(with bits of: “ain’t no fun..”-AC/DC, “dog eat Dog - AC/DC, “rock the
nation”-Montrose etc..)
one of the hottest club shows we’ve done - performace AND the temperature!!!
sound was great - audience crazed & we just had a blast!! The guys from
Leatherwolf, Jason from the Flots, the Death Angel guys also - came out to
see the show…
following us Tony Martin played - great melodic metal - and he played a few
Sabbath tunes from the “headless cross” era as well as “children of the sea”
- all in all a great night!

So, back to the hotel, & down to the local bar for …ice cream???? I leave
the beer to my capable cohorts!! & off to kip!!

Friday - the van arrives late, we arrive at the festival site, I am ushered
up to the stage to confer with the stage manager to be told the German
government have some officials checking all the wireless units used by the
bands & only “prescribed frequencies” can be used…fearing I’m gonna be
chained to a mike stand instead of having my headset mike I cross me fingers
& hand over my gear to the govt. guys…they come back & all is well - thank
god!

The stage has a large area backstage with 3 drum kits on risers - the change
over period between bands is an amazing 15 minutes - ultra pro crew - the old drum kit is wheeled off, the new one wheeled on..we set up our racks & pedals…do a quick line check, are introduced & we are on! weather is glorious - not sure how many people but its a LOT..and they are totally into the show!! huge stage with a platform reaching into the crowd & side wings out by the P.A. -
we are all over them of course!
TAKE CONTROL
LIVE AT THE INFERNO
LAMBS TO THE SLAUGHTER
ALL FOR ONE
BREAKING YOU DOWN
ROCK UNTIL YOU DROP
BASS INTERLUDE(TYRANT OF THE AIRWAYS BIT)
Mark’s amp blows up…impromptu bass solo follows as they get him a
Marshall…
SPEED/RUN/MIND MEDLEY
BREAK THE CHAIN
(this time with “I’ don’t need no doctor”-Humble Pie - in the jam bit…)
guitars are trashed & we all end up on the front platform taking a bow -
just THE BEST!!! an amazing reception & we are well pleased!!!

Following getting the gear together & recovering, we meet Horst - the “chef”
of the event and yack for 20 min or so - then its about 4 hours straight of interviews, taped - videoed & live on the radio - we do a signing session and finally get some food!

Great to see Chris Tsangerides after 26 years!!! and hang out with the other
bands - Foreigner play a blinder - hit after hit..squeezing “whole lotta love” into
“juke box hero” and we hitch a ride back to our hotel.

We go back the next day to hustle our demo - meet more bands - Joey & John
from Armored Saint - jeez..its been a while! - and get to watch Count Raven, the Saint(kicking ass) Pretty Maids, Stratovarius & Whitesnake ….and the stripper with the white python!…!!!

off to the hotel for more ice cream/soccer/beer..6.00am wake up and back to the airport!!!

Thanks to Horst & Jagger and all involved with the festival - and to everyone we met - and especially the fans, such a great atmosphere & reception!!!

the show was videoed & we will appear on the offical DVD - probably out next
year..
cheers, John

Raven records 4 new songs!

Filed under: News — ravenmad @ 8:16 am

Raven went into the studio and recorded 4 new songs recently . Songs recorded were “Against The Grain”, “Running Around In Circles”, “Breaking You Down”, and “Necessary Evil”. The band expects to go back into the studio soon to record more songs.
